I made barbecue sauce one day just for fun, because I was tired of all the store-bought brands. I said, ‘Why not try to make some myself?’
I started making barbecue sauce for cooking and special events. Over the years, there were many different variations, but I always migrated back to my signature sauce.
My wife Renee and I began making the sauce in our kitchen in our little house in Sicklerville. It was always fun to do together. We started giving it away as Christmas gifts. People looked forward to it every year. They couldn’t wait to see that jar or bottle, whatever I got that year. It was definitely something special to see the excitement on people’s faces when we handed it out at Christmas. Renee would always say, “You should start a business selling your barbecue sauce”, and I always told her that one day, Shawn’s Wicked Awesome Barbecue sauce would be everywhere. She was my biggest supporter and my biggest critic. There were some flavors she loved, and some flavors she didn’t.
She designed the label that I used today, except for the addition of the green heart.
In 2021, Renee was diagnosed with cancer. That year, I wasn’t going to make sauce because things were just crazy, and she said, “You have to make a batch. People are expecting it. You have to keep the tradition.” Even though we didn’t get to make it together that year, she still pushed me to do it. So, with all the craziness going on, I scraped up everything I needed to make a batch of sauce. Unfortunately, in 2022, I lost Renee. She was my biggest supporter and my best friend. When Christmas came, and I heard her voice say, “You’ve got to get moving. You need to make a batch of sauce. Christmas is coming.” I did just that. I made that batch of sauce in the kitchen of our new house, but I had to do it by myself.
It was that day, and I decided that I needed to make the sauce for everyone to have, not just people for Christmas. So the painstaking process of figuring out how to get my sauce to everyone to enjoy started in the spring of 2023.
All said and done. It took until the summer of 2024 to finally get my first batch of sauce. It was a great feeling to have that first jar come off the processing line. It had Renee’s label on it with the addition of the green heart.
The green heart is a symbol of her. It was her thing to sign every text message with green hearts. So I decided to put the green heart on the label for everyone to have a little piece of her with every jar.
